What is the difference between loyalty and obligation?

While loyalty and obligation may seem interchangeable, they have distinct connotations. Loyalty implies a deep-seated commitment to someone or something, whereas obligation suggests a sense of duty or responsibility. Understanding this distinction is key to navigating complex relationships and making informed decisions.
